The French dix franc note, which features a denomination of ten francs, is no longer in circulation, as France transitioned to the euro in 2002. The value of a dix franc note can vary based on its condition, rarity, and collector demand, but it typically ranges from a few euros to over twenty euros for well-preserved examples. Collectors often seek out these notes, making them a niche item in the numismatic market.

What was the value in US dollars of the french franc in 1932?

In 1932, the French franc was worth about four cents (25.46 to the American dollar or 3.92 cents). By 1939 and the start of WWII, the franc had shrunk to just about 2.5 cents. During and after the war, the franc was worth anybody's guess, what with Vichy money and American and British issued francs after the war. For comparison, the British pound in 1932 was worth roughly $5, so the franc was worth a bit less than 2 pence. (Remember, this was before metrification, so a british pound was worth 20 shillings and a shilling was worth 12 pence, so a pound was worth 240 pence.)
